Common Materials for DIY Rodent Repellents
When considering DIY solutions to repel rodents, a variety of materials can be effectively utilized. These materials often include both common household items and natural ingredients that are known for their repellent properties. **Essential oils** like peppermint, eucalyptus, and citronella are popular choices due to their strong scents which rodents find unappealing. Vinegar is another common ingredient, valued for its strong odor, which can deter mice and rats when sprayed around entry points. Additionally, **hot pepper** solutions, which can be made from cayenne pepper mixed with water, are often utilized as rodents dislike the spicy sensation.
Other items that can be used include **baking soda and flour**. While baking soda is safe for humans, it can create digestive problems for rodents if ingested while mixed with flour, which can attract them initially. Additionally, some DIY repellents include **mothballs** or **dried bay leaves**. Mothballs release a strong chemical scent which can discourage rodents, while bay leaves are often placed in cupboards and storage areas to prevent infestation. Lastly, **ultrasonic devices**, though requiring some electronic components, can be combined with these natural ingredients for a more robust solution.
When creating your own rodent repellents, it’s crucial to consider the effectiveness of these materials. Many of them do work to a certain degree, primarily due to their strong odors or taste that rodents dislike. However, results can vary based on usage, the environment, and the specific species of rodent being targeted. It’s important to repeat applications periodically as natural ingredients can lose potency over time, and to use these repellents in conjunction with good sanitation practices to ensure that your environment is less inviting to pests.

Regarding DIY electronic rodent repellents, several solutions can be assembled using basic electronic components, like ultrasonic sound emitters. These devices generate sound waves at frequencies that are typically inaudible to humans but can be disruptive to rodents. There are plenty of online guides on constructing simple circuits that emit these ultrasonic frequencies, which can be placed strategically in areas where rodent activity is noticed.
However, these DIY electronic solutions are not without their challenges. The effectiveness of ultrasonic repellents can be debated, as some studies suggest that their impact may diminish over time as rodents adapt to the sound. Additionally, proper placement and ensuring that the sound can propagate without obstruction are crucial for the efficacy of such devices. Electronic Components Used in DIY Solutions
In the realm of DIY rodent repellents, electronic components can play a crucial role in creating devices that deter rodents through sound, light, or electromagnetic fields. One popular method is the use of ultrasonic pest repellents, which emit high-frequency sound waves that are inaudible to humans but can be highly irritating to rodents. These devices typically require simple electrical components like a sound generator, a speaker or transducer, and a power source, such as batteries or an AC adapter.
In addition to ultrasonic devices, some DIY solutions might integrate motion sensors. These sensors can be programmed to trigger lights or sounds when they detect movement, mimicking the presence of predators and creating a disruptive environment for rodents. By using everyday electronic components such as microcontrollers (like Arduino or Raspberry Pi), hobbyists can craft sophisticated devices that can be adjusted and programmed according to specific needs and environments.

Safety Considerations for DIY Repellents
When considering DIY rodent repellents, safety is a paramount concern. Many of the ingredients commonly used in homemade repellents may pose health risks to humans and pets. For instance, essential oils, while effective in repelling rodents, can cause allergic reactions or respiratory issues if inhaled or ingested in sufficient quantities. It is crucial to ensure good ventilation when using any potent odorants in your home and to keep all repellent materials out of reach of children and pets. Further, some natural ingredients, such as capsaicin from chili peppers, can irritate the skin or eyes, and care should be taken to handle them properly.
Additionally, when constructing DIY electronic repellents, the safety of the device itself should be taken into account. Ensuring that the components are assembled correctly and housed in a safe manner will prevent electrical hazards. Using appropriate materials and following guidelines can minimize risks of fire or electrical shock. It’s also wise to be cautious about placement; for instance, using devices near water sources can pose significant risks unless properly insulated.

Maintenance and Monitoring of DIY Rodent Repellents
Maintaining and monitoring DIY rodent repellents is crucial for ensuring their ongoing effectiveness. Repellents, whether they are natural mixtures or electronic devices, can lose potency over time or become less effective if not properly managed. For instance, natural repellents made from ingredients like peppermint oil or vinegar may evaporate or degrade, making it necessary to reapply them regularly. It’s important to plan a maintenance schedule that aligns with the specific materials used in your DIY solution.
When it comes to electronic rodent repellents, regular monitoring is key to determining their effectiveness. Users should check for signs of rodent activity in the areas where the repellents are deployed. This includes inspecting for droppings, gnaw marks, or nests, which indicate that the measures may not be working as intended. Additionally, one should keep an eye on the functionality of the electronic devices themselves; this may involve checking batteries, ensuring that devices are properly positioned, and verifying that they are emitting the intended sound frequencies or vibrations.
Moreover, monitoring can also involve assessing the environment in which the repellents are used. Factors such as changes in weather or the introduction of new food sources can impact the success of rodent control measures. Keeping a log of rodent sightings and conditions may help inform adjustments to the DIY repellent strategy.
